hehe, your carb is on backwards buddy! i like the black intake manifold though...what did you use to paint it, or is that a powdercoat?
Yeah, I know it was just mock up. However I figured someone would comment on it.
As for the manifold it is actually rattled canned. I soaked it the night before in greased lightning and let it sit in there overnight. I bought two gallons of it for ten bucks. Then I washed it off and dried it out in the morning. Afterwords I took some high build automotive primer to it and then rattle canned it low gloss black with that hi-temp engine paint. It came out really nice despite what I was expecting. I just didn't want to worry about having to clean one more thing on the engine all the time as aluminum has a tendency to spot.

hey 91camarors305, did you take your tensioner apart to get that belt set up to work? I remember seeing someone on here with something like that, and he said he took the tensioner apart and fliped the spring around. I tried, but everyone at my shop was sayin it was pretty dangerous and probably wont be able to put it back together with tension.

i just bought a shorter belt and the belt has the ribbed side to the tensioner and not the smooth side.....i think it was a 5060850 i think. the tensioner wants to pull the belt to the left so thats how it keeps the tension on it, no need to flip anything around, just make sure you run the w/p, alt, and ps pump in the correct direction
oh and you need a 6 grooved 3" tensioner pulley, all thats holds it in is a bolt and that is is

The car is definately awake now though, put the Quickfuel 750 DP with proform mainbody and mechanical secondaries on it Wednesday. I didn't know how bad my car had been wanting to go till then. I had been choking it with a 1406 edelbrock 600cfm on an out of the box "best mileage" tune. If you need the edelbrock let me know ;p
no, i don't need the edelbrock, lol! i've built my own HP holley. i'm glad you finally got a real carb on it though! i dropped .5 with the old 305 when i went from a 600cfm vacuum secondary to a 600cfm double pumper. then i put on a 650 main body and dropped another .2! i have a 750 main body and throttle blade plate that i wanna do some tweakin' with...though even with shift points above 6K, i don't know that the little 305 is gonna need that much carb. but i got it and it's a tuning tool.
